I am interested in my HF Friends' opinion here. What are your thoughts on this season? It feels really dumb. The repeat stuff is bad. It feels like I'm watching multiple different leagues. I think it will lead to some ugly playoffs.

Don't get me wrong. I'm thankful. I'm happy. I'm content. But just discussing the hockey and leaving the outside stuff away, how do you all feel about it?

Not to be a contrarian but I posted something about this yesterday.

In short, I like the compacted season against regional rivals. I don't think the hockey is any different. Looks like the same players are good, the same teams playing.

As a rare event (these couple seasons) I think it's been an interesting exercise. I like playing rivals all the time (I was always in favor of the miniseries) and the compressed season enhances the importance.

They were better prepared this year than last. Seasons are never on even ground (travel time for other divisions, cap disparity, etc). If anything, they're more in the same boat now than ever.

I really miss the fan impact on the game but it's been legitimate hockey.
